We Are What We Eat
We Are What We Eat
Many people around the world are dying of heart disease and stroke every day. There has been extensive research done to determine the cause of these health problems, among hereditary factors, and environmental issues, one major contributing factor, which can be controlled, is what we eat. Food can be the ultimate demon to our bodies.
High cholesterol levels can block all the major arteries in the heart, which means the heart will eventually stop beating, if blood is unable to flow freely throughout the body. We are what we eat, what we put into our bodies can determine the outcome of what our bodies can do for us. If we feed our body junk, it will slowly deteriorate and turn into junk from the inside out.
